    Abstract: This invention provides a method for the production of dense soda ash by reacting sodium carbonate decahydrate with a light soda ash or soda ash fines at an elevated temperature to produce sodium carbonate monohydrate crystals, and drying the sodium carbonate monohydrate to produce dense soda ash.

    Abstract: A process for recovering alkali values from trona ore by partially dissolving trona in a first dissolving solution to form a first feed liquor and undissolved trona. The first feed liquor is cooled and sodium carbonate decahydrate is precipitated. The sodium carbonate decahydrate is recovered from the resultant first mother liquor that is returned as the first dissolving solution. The undissolved trona is further dissolved in a second dissolving solution to form a second feed liquor. The second feed liquor is preferably carbonated to convert sodium carbonate into sodium bicarbonate, and cooled to precipitate sodium bicarbonate. The sodium bicarbonate is recovered from the resultant second mother liquor that is returned as the second dissolving solution.

    Abstract: A process for recovery of alkali values from trona ore comprising (a) dissolving the trona ore, (b) separating the insoluble material to obtain an alkali containing feed liquor, (c) cooling the feed liquor and crystallizing sodium bicarbonate and separating the bicarbonate crystals from the resulting mother liquor, (d) cooling the mother liquor and crystallizing sodium carbonate decahydrate and separating the decahydrate crystals from a weak liquor, and (e) treating the sodium carbonate decahydrate crystals to recover the alkali values therein.
